I would follow these instruction, by mckinneycm, for best results

Quote:
Originally Posted by mckinneycm View Post
I just went back to .247. I uninstalled ALL versions from my PC. Wiped with JL_Cmder, installed .247 on my PC, ran Loader.exe, ran a restore of my .247 backup, and then activated on BES. All is good and back to where I was this morning.

Originally Posted by nick.dollimount View Post
When editing profiles, we get some more vibrate options.

Length:
-Short
-Medium
-Long

Count:
1, 2, 3, 5, 10

With Volume now, you get to choose from 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10 instead of the three options before. And there's a Try It button at the bottom.

Also they're organized MUCH nicer in this one.

I haven't had a Storm so maybe these are options that the Storm has? I have no clue. Just mentioning what's different for the Bold. =)
